A national model has to price Tulsa and Tampa with the same arithmetic. Every closed sale in Sacramento County fuels our model — which is why it can tell Meadowview from Citrus Heights — same median price today, not the same momentum.
Every one valued using only the comparable sales that existed on the day it closed — because valuing a house with sales that happened afterwards is how a model flatters itself.
